The other NDE was against the summoner. For those of you who don't know how his Fire Wall works, it deals 5 damage every frame, which means 125 damage per second. I had a Circlet with 3 magic damage reduction and a ring with 2. The Summoner cast his Firewall all me, and I stood in it, taking zero damage. Hooray! I started laughing. His Glacial Spike soared in and blasted away half my health. I stopped laughing real quick. I let Iantha clear out his platform and went to finish him, he cast a glacial spike on me, I used a red, he cast another, I was at a sliver, I frantically used a purple and finished him off. I bet if I hadn't used the red, I would have died to the second spike.

Kaiko put her mf boots in the chest before entering, to maximize the chance of some one-handed 5 sox weapon dropping for Honor. No luck though.

It´s impossible for an item to drop with more than 3 sockets in Normal difficulty (4 in Nightmare).

However, if you make the sockets yourself (Larzuk or recipe) these caps do not apply, and the standard item level related sockets list is used.
